Well, it's pretty hard to pull off a horror where the protagonist is a self-sustaining badass. Horrors are meant to focus on the powerlessness of the hero and pressure crushing down on them. That pressure and powerlessness dissipate if the protagonist is someone who is dangerous, brave, and confident in their independence.

Predator pulled it off by keeping enough of the action genre at its heart and using elements of horror to create a villain terrifying and mysterious enough that it just might be able to handle the most kickass man society could create.
